Filter details
The NSF certified Pure Carbon Block filters use coconut carbon filtration technology to maximize the carbon capacity and prevent channelling whilst maintaining a low pressure drop leading to more efficient water filtration.
Suited to processes where the life of the carbon is never fully used. A carbon cartridge manufactured from acid washed bituminous Granular Activated Carbon
(GAC) and extruded into a carbon block format. Constructed with an outer polypropylene wrap that protects and extends the life of the carbon block, capturing particles and preventing premature plugging
Top-of-the-line carbon block filter cartridge for chlorine, taste, odor and sediment reduction

The filter is a compatible replacement water filter cartridge for similar 10" filter housings including brands such as Pentek, Ametek, Culligan, Whirlpool and so on. It will fit all under sink water filter housings which use a standard size small 10" x 2.5" filter replacement cartridge. Filter System The NSF approved 5 Micron Carbon Block filters (also certified by ISO) use coconut carbon filtration technology to maximize the carbon capacity and prevent channelling whilst maintaining a low pressure drop leading to more efficient water filtration. 2.5" x 10" Carbon Filter Specifications: Construction Notes 1. Outer polypropylene wrap extends the life of the block by preventing premature plugging. 2. Carbon block extruded from acid washed bituminous activated carbon. Technical Data Micron Ratings (μ) 5 Lengths (") 9¾ Maximum Operating Temperature (°C) 82 Maximum Operating Pressure (bar) 17, Initial @ Flow* 2.0 psid @ 1.0 gpm** Chlorine Reduction (L) > 3,000 gallons@ 0.5 gpm Length (nominal mm) 248 Outside Diameter (nominal mm) 65 Inside Diameter (nominal mm) 28 1. Projected Chlorine taste and odor reduction capacity when tasted in accordance with NSF/ANSI42 protocol.* 2. Nominal particulate rating is for >85% of a given size as determined from single - pass particle counting results.** |
